Understanding the Two Paths: What Are You Actually Choosing Between

Before you compare, you need to understand what each option actually involves.

What Is a Template-Based eCommerce Website

A template is a pre-designed layout available on platforms like Shopify, WooCommerce, or Wix. You pick a theme, upload your products, add your logo and colors, and you are live. Thousands of other businesses are using the same base structure. The customization is limited to what the theme allows you to change.

Templates are popular because they reduce time to launch. For a business testing the waters of eCommerce, they can seem like the sensible first step. But there is a difference between getting online quickly and building something that works for your business long term.

What Is Custom eCommerce Website Design

A custom eCommerce website is built from the ground up around your specific business requirements. The design, user experience, checkout flow, navigation, product pages, and integrations are all designed with your brand and your customers in mind. Nothing is borrowed or repurposed from a generic layout.

Custom development takes longer and costs more at the outset. But it gives you a platform that fits your business instead of asking your business to fit the platform.

Why Mumbai Brands Face a Different Set of Challenges

Mumbai is not just any city. It is one of India’s most active commercial hubs with a consumer base that is digitally savvy, highly mobile, and extremely selective. Your customers are shopping on phones during commutes, comparing products across tabs, and making decisions fast. A slow, generic website loses them in seconds.

The city also has enormous diversity in its buyer segments. A template may work passably for a small business selling generic products nationally. But if you are targeting a specific Mumbai demographic, whether it is the high-spending South Mumbai crowd or value-conscious buyers in the suburbs, your website needs to speak their language visually and functionally.

There is also the matter of local payment preferences. UPI, Razorpay, net banking, and cash on delivery remain prominent across different buyer groups. A template may support basic payment gateways but rarely handles the nuanced checkout experience that Indian shoppers expect without additional development work anyway.

These are real-world realities that a cookie-cutter theme simply is not designed to address.

The Case for Templates: Where They Actually Make Sense

To be fair, templates are not without merit. There are situations where they are a reasonable choice.

  • You are a first-time seller with a small product catalogue and a tight budget who needs to test demand quickly.
  • You are running a short-term promotional store tied to a campaign or event.
  • Your product category is simple, your needs are basic, and you do not need any functionality beyond a standard product-cart-checkout flow.
  • You plan to migrate to a custom build once you have validated your concept and grown your revenue.

In these specific scenarios, starting with a template is a practical decision. The problem arises when businesses use templates as a permanent solution and then wonder why their conversion rates are flat, their brand feels forgettable, and scaling becomes a technical headache.

Performance Is Built In, Not Patched On

Templates carry code bloat from features you are not using. Every unnecessary plugin and design element adds weight to your site. Page speed is a direct ranking factor for Google and a direct conversion factor for your buyers. A custom eCommerce website is lean by design. The code does exactly what your business needs and nothing more, resulting in faster load times and better SEO performance.

The SEO Advantage of Custom eCommerce Websites

Search engine optimisation for eCommerce is one of the most competitive areas of digital marketing in India. If you want your Mumbai-based store to rank for keywords that your buyers are actually searching, your website structure matters enormously.

Custom eCommerce websites allow for clean URL structures, optimised site architecture, schema markup tailored to product categories, fast core web vitals, and properly structured internal linking. These are things that template themes handle inconsistently at best.

When Google crawls a well-built custom eCommerce site, it finds clarity, speed, and relevance. That translates to better rankings, more organic traffic, and reduced dependence on paid advertising over time.

The Real Cost Comparison: Upfront vs Long-Term

The most common objection to custom development is cost. A template costs a few hundred rupees per month. A custom website can cost anywhere from a few lakhs to significantly more depending on scope. But this comparison only makes sense if you look at the first year in isolation.

Consider what a template actually costs over three years once you add premium theme fees, plugin subscriptions for features the template does not include, developer time for workarounds when the template hits limitations, lost revenue from slow load times, cart abandonment from poor UX, and eventually the cost of migrating to a proper custom platform anyway.

The total cost of ownership often surprises business owners when they do the honest math. A custom eCommerce website built properly is an investment with a clear return, not just an expense.

Making the Decision: Questions to Ask Before You Choose

Before you commit to either path, run through these questions honestly.

  • Is eCommerce a primary revenue channel for your business now or in the next two years?
  • Do you have specific UX requirements that a standard template cannot accommodate?
  • Is brand differentiation important in your product category?
  • Are you planning to scale your product catalogue significantly?
  • Do you need custom integrations with ERP, inventory, or logistics platforms?
  • Is organic search a key part of your customer acquisition strategy?

If you answered yes to most of these, a custom eCommerce website is not optional. It is the right business decision. If you are at the very beginning of your eCommerce journey with minimal requirements and need proof of concept, a template may bridge the gap temporarily.

How long does it take to build a custom eCommerce website?

A well-scoped custom eCommerce project typically takes between 6 to 16 weeks depending on complexity, the number of product pages, integrations required, and how quickly the client can provide content and approvals. Rushing a custom build to save time usually creates problems that cost more to fix later.

Can I migrate from a template-based store to a custom eCommerce website later?

Yes, migration is possible and happens regularly. However, it involves data migration, SEO considerations, redirects, and rebuilding the customer experience from scratch. It is doable but more expensive and disruptive than starting with custom development from the beginning if you already know your requirements.

Which platform is best for custom eCommerce development in India?

The right platform depends on your business requirements. WooCommerce built on WordPress offers extensive flexibility for content-rich businesses. Shopify works well for product-led stores with simpler customisation needs. Fully custom builds on frameworks like Laravel or Node.js are suited for businesses with complex workflows and unique functionality requirements. A good web design partner will help you choose based on your specific situation.

Does a custom eCommerce website really rank better on Google?

A custom website does not automatically rank better simply because it is custom. But it gives you the technical foundation to implement SEO correctly. Clean code, fast load speeds, proper site architecture, schema markup, and mobile optimisation are all far easier to achieve with a custombuild than with a heavily modified template. When these factors are implemented well, ranking improvements follow.
